A recent TikTok video has gone viral following Manchester United’s visit to Malaysia for their match against the ASEAN All-Stars.

In the clip, one of the Manchester United players was seen flipping his middle finger while getting off the team bus and walking past the crowd in Kuala Lumpur after their defeat on May 29 (Thursday).

Supporters were chanting his name

According to Berita Harian, Amad Diallo came on as a second-half substitute during Manchester United’s 1-0 loss.

After the defeat, the players were booed and jeered by fans. United manager Ruben Amorim, whose team finished 15th in the Premier League, said the squad shouldn’t avoid facing their supporters.

In a video shared by a fan on social media, Amad was seen walking past a group of supporters chanting his name before raising his middle finger, seemingly directed at the local crowd.

“I don’t regret what I did”

In response to the backlash, Amad addressed the incident on X, saying he had no regrets as he was allegedly reacting to an insult directed at his mother.

While he acknowledged that he shouldn’t have made an obscene hand gesture toward fans, he wrote:

“I have respect for people, but not for the one who insults my mother. I shouldn’t have reacted like that, but I don’t regret what I did. We had a great time in Malaysia with good people.”

Another player was spotted doing the same gesture

Meanwhile, in a separate incident, another Manchester United winger, Alejandro Garnacho, was also caught making a similar obscene gesture.

Following United’s first match of the tour, Alejandro was seen flipping off the camera as he walked off the pitch at the National Stadium.

Later, during a photo session with two fans, both Amad and Alejandro were once again seen making the same offensive hand gesture while posing with the group.
